Output def63bd39aa1635da7109df948801e01cbb070431362991c0ba8cf46b61185f1:0

value
11541500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a59d1e14e22224f50bbc0c04981ff146cb4acf OP_EQUAL
address
3CWN4DxHivyBVyAHDybSe5Yr5KQczAKLxA
transaction
def63bd39aa1635da7109df948801e01cbb070431362991c0ba8cf46b61185f1
confirmations
258580
spent
true